Izien started 40 games at safety for Rutgers across the last four seasons, including 24 of the Scarlet Knights’ 25 games in the past two years. Thefinishes his college career with 303 tackles, 19 passes defended, 15.5 tackles for loss, four interceptions and three fumble recoveries in 50 appearances.
